gpt4 book ai didi

iPhone:创建类似 Facebook 的 UI、皮肤应用程序,不遵循 AHIG

转载 作者:行者123 更新时间:2023-12-03 20:24:24 25 4
gpt4 key购买 nike

  1. 如何设计像 Facebook 这样的用户界面?
  2. 在 iPhone 应用程序中实现自定义皮肤很难吗?是如何做到的?
  3. 我需要遵守苹果的指南吗?如果我不想怎么办?

最佳答案

How do you design a UI like Facebook?

Facebook 的 iPhone 应用程序似乎是以各种形式围绕使用 UITableView 构建的。看起来它符合 Apple 人机界面指南。

Is it hard to implement a custom skin into a iphone app? How is it done?

皮肤只是图形元素,旨在替换其图像组件。它们并不难实现。

Do I need to follow apple's guideline? What if I dont want to?

Apple 不会因为非标准接口(interface)而惩罚您。唯一的界面限制是(1)存在一些淫秽内容问题,以及(2)您不能造成设备本身损坏、崩溃或出现其他故障的假象。

一点建议。不要使用非标准接口(interface)。

好的界面几乎在定义上都是标准化的,因此用户不必考虑它们。新颖的界面会降低用户的速度,即使他们在其他方面没有问题。有时只需尝试在 Mac、Windows 和 Linux 之间快速切换即可。这些界面本身都没有重大问题,但必须停下来思考如何在每个特定界面中做某事是一种痛苦。您可以通过在应用程序中使用良好但非标准的界面来产生相同的问题。

当然,这是假设您实际上可以创建一个好的界面。制作糟糕的界面的方法比制作好的界面的方法要多得多。大多数界面甚至连界面之神设计的界面都失败了。标准化接口(interface)是数万小时测试和多年经验的结果。你不太可能第一次就想出一些真正新的、有用的东西。

如果你尝试一些新颖的东西,我建议你先模拟它,然后测试,让人们测试它,而不给他们任何指导。你会惊讶地发现它会变得多么复杂。我们过去只是制作 Photoshop 模型,然后询问测试用户他们认为每个元素的作用是什么,或者他们会选择哪个元素来完成特定任务。我们对我们(开发人员)对界面的感知与用户的感知如此严重的重叠感到惊讶。

总而言之,新颖的界面更有可能损害你的应用而不是帮助它。

关于iPhone:创建类似 Facebook 的 UI、皮肤应用程序,不遵循 AHIG,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2270060/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com